Why Italian flavors shine on Bonaire

Bonaire is known for an international food culture that brings together tastes from around the world—including Italy—served with tropical accents. You’ll find global influences woven through local dining, with ingredients and techniques that reflect the island’s diverse heritage.

This island-wide culinary strength has earned recognition: Bonaire was named a Culinary Capital by the World Food Travel Association in June 2022. It’s the kind of place where you can explore Caribbean seafood one night and enjoy Italian-inspired dishes the next, all within a compact, easy-to-navigate destination.

Exactly where to find and use the Italian Restaurant Type filter

You’ll locate the filter inside the Restaurants directory under Experiences › Cuisine. The directory lists 34 restaurants and gives you tools to narrow your search fast.

Follow these steps to surface Italian restaurants on Bonaire:

  1. Open Experiences › Cuisine › Restaurants.
  2. In the filters panel, look for Type and select Italian. (Types include Asian, BBQ and Pizza, Buffet, Café, Dessert & Bakery, Distillery, Fine Dining, Food Truck/Cart/Stand, French, International, Italian, Local Cuisine (Krioyo), and Other.)
  3. Click Apply Filters to view only venues that match your selection.
  4. Optionally combine Region filters—Central, East, Klein Bonaire, North, South, or Washington Slagbaai National Park—to find an Italian spot close to your plans.
  5. Use the Keyword Search field to refine by dishes such as “pizza” or “pasta.”
  6. To reset and see the full directory again, click Clear All Filters (this returns the complete list of 34 restaurants).
